Exploring Animation Programs For Beginners

Animation is a thriving art form that combines creativity, technology, and storytelling. Whether you are an aspiring artist or a hobbyist looking to dabble in animation, there are plenty of beginner-friendly programs available to help you get started. From simple, user-friendly software to more advanced tools with a bit of a learning curve, there is an animation program out there to suit every skill level and goal.

One of the most popular animation programs for beginners is Adobe Animate. Formerly known as Flash, Adobe Animate is a versatile tool that allows users to create a wide range of animations, from simple cartoons to interactive web content. With a sleek and intuitive interface, Adobe Animate is easy to navigate and offers a variety of drawing and animation tools to help beginners bring their ideas to life. For those who are familiar with other Adobe products such as Photoshop or Illustrator, the transition to Adobe Animate should be relatively seamless.

Another great option for beginners is Toon Boom Harmony. This professional-grade software is widely used in the animation industry and offers a comprehensive set of tools for both 2D and 3D animation. While Toon Boom Harmony may have a steeper learning curve than some other programs, its powerful features and advanced capabilities make it a valuable investment for aspiring animators looking to take their skills to the next level. With a bit of patience and practice, beginners can create stunning animations with Toon Boom Harmony.

For those who prefer a more user-friendly approach, programs like Pencil2D and Synfig Studio are excellent choices for beginners. Pencil2D is a free, open-source program that allows users to create simple 2D animations with ease. With an intuitive interface and basic drawing tools, Pencil2D is perfect for beginners who are just starting out in the world of animation. Synfig Studio is another free program that offers a wide range of features for creating 2D animations. While it may not be as polished as some of the more professional programs, Synfig Studio is a great option for beginners on a budget who are looking to experiment with different animation techniques.

If you are interested in trying your hand at 3D animation, programs like Blender and Autodesk Maya are excellent choices for beginners. Blender is a free, open-source program that offers a wide range of features for creating 3D animations, including modeling, rigging, and texturing tools. While Blender may have a bit of a learning curve for beginners, there are plenty of tutorials and resources available online to help you get started. Autodesk Maya is a more advanced program that is widely used in the film and gaming industries. While Maya may be overwhelming for absolute beginners, its powerful features and professional-grade tools make it an excellent choice for aspiring 3D animators looking to create high-quality animations.
